What the probe found
1 of the 10 tools listed anonymously say in their own descriptions that they need an account or a key (forget_all_memories), but the endpoint issued no WWW-Authenticate challenge. The requirement is stated only in prose, so a call reaches the tool and comes back as a tool error instead of an authorization step.
The server exposes a public surface before authorization: search_memories, date_search_memories, store_memory, memory_status, forget_all_memories, consolidate_memories, commit_reflections, inspect_memory, delete_memories, search.
